How AI Processes and Learns from Data
Artificial intelligence transforms raw data into intelligent insights through sophisticated learning mechanisms. AI algorithms work like complex neural networks, processing information across multiple interconnected layers. These systems simulate human-like learning by analyzing patterns, extracting features, and making intelligent ai decision making processes.
The core of how artificial intelligence functions lies in its ability to learn from data through intricate processes:
- Input Layer: Receives initial data signals
- Hidden Layers: Process and transform information
- Output Layer: Generates predictions or decisions
Deep learning models leverage artificial neural networks with multiple layers of computational units. Each unit receives inputs, assigns weights, performs calculations, and passes results to subsequent layers. During training, these models automatically adapt and refine their internal parameters to minimize prediction errors.
AI algorithms utilize optimization techniques that iteratively update neural network weights. This enables the system to recognize complex patterns beyond traditional programming approaches. The learning process involves:
- Data collection and preprocessing
- Feature extraction
- Model training
- Prediction generation
Through continuous exposure to data, AI systems develop increasingly sophisticated understanding, enabling them to make intelligent decisions across diverse domains.

The Four Main Types of Artificial Intelligence
Computational intelligence systems represent a fascinating spectrum of technological capabilities. AI technology fundamentals classify artificial intelligence into four distinct types, each with unique characteristics and potential for transforming how machines interact with the world.
Reactive machines serve as the most basic form of computational intelligence. These AI systems operate purely on current inputs without memory or learning capabilities. Classic examples include chess computers and simple voice assistants that respond to immediate commands without understanding context.
- Reactive machines analyze current situations
- No ability to learn from past experiences
- Limited to specific, predefined tasks
Limited memory AI represents a more advanced stage of computational intelligence. These systems can retain short-term information and use historical data to make informed decisions. Self-driving cars demonstrate this type of AI by analyzing recent road conditions, vehicle positions, and traffic patterns to navigate safely.
Two theoretical AI types continue to challenge researchers:
- Theory of mind AI: Systems that understand human emotions and predict behavior
- Self-aware AI: Hypothetical machines with genuine consciousness
While these advanced computational intelligence systems remain speculative, they represent exciting frontiers in AI technology fundamentals. Researchers continue exploring how machines might develop deeper understanding and potentially approximate human-like cognitive processes.
Machine Learning Fundamentals Explained
Machine learning represents a powerful subset of artificial intelligence that enables computers to learn and improve from experience without being explicitly programmed. As a core component of how AI algorithms function, machine learning provides systems the ability to automatically learn and enhance their performance by analyzing data patterns.
At its core, machine learning explained simply means teaching computers to recognize patterns and make intelligent decisions. The field encompasses several key learning approaches that help machines understand and process information.
Types of Machine Learning Approaches
Machine learning basics can be categorized into three primary learning paradigms:
- Supervised Learning: Models trained using labeled datasets
- Unsupervised Learning: Discovering hidden patterns in unlabeled data
- Reinforcement Learning: Learning through interaction and feedback
Supervised Learning Techniques
In supervised learning, AI models learn from pre-labeled training data. These algorithms map input data to known output labels, enabling precise predictions across various domains such as:
- Image recognition
- Spam email detection
- Medical diagnosis prediction
Reinforcement Learning Dynamics
Reinforcement learning represents a unique approach where AI agents learn through trial and error. By receiving rewards or penalties for specific actions, these models gradually develop optimal strategies in complex environments like game playing or robotic control systems.
Deep Learning and Neural Network Architecture
Deep learning represents a powerful subset of machine learning that revolutionizes how artificial intelligence understands complex data. The deep learning process involves neural networks with multiple layers that can automatically extract intricate features from raw information.
Neural network architecture forms the backbone of deep learning processes. These sophisticated systems mimic human brain functionality by creating interconnected layers that progressively learn more abstract representations of data.
- Convolutional Neural Networks (CNNs) excel at processing image data
- Recurrent Neural Networks (RNNs) specialize in sequential information
- Feedforward Networks handle standard supervised learning tasks
Deep learning principles enable machines to recognize patterns without manual feature engineering. By designing networks with strategic layer configurations, AI systems can tackle increasingly complex challenges across various domains.
The architecture of these neural networks determines their performance. Researchers carefully select network depth, width, and connectivity to optimize learning capabilities. Each layer learns to detect specific features, from simple edges to intricate object recognitions.
Modern AI breakthroughs in facial recognition, speech processing, and natural language generation all stem from advanced deep learning techniques. These neural networks transform raw data into meaningful insights through their sophisticated architectural design.

The AI Pipeline: From Data to Deployment
Understanding how AI technology functions requires a deep dive into the complex journey of transforming raw data into intelligent systems. The AI pipeline represents a critical roadmap that guides artificial intelligence from conceptualization to real-world application.
Neural networks fundamentals play a crucial role in this intricate process. The pipeline encompasses several key stages that work together to create powerful AI solutions:
- Data Collection: Gathering information from diverse sources
- Data Preprocessing: Cleaning and preparing datasets
- Feature Engineering: Extracting meaningful patterns
- Model Training: Teaching AI systems to recognize complex patterns
- Model Evaluation: Assessing performance and accuracy
- Deployment: Integrating AI into real-world environments
Data Collection and Preprocessing
Understanding neural networks begins with high-quality data. Researchers meticulously collect information from multiple channels, including databases, sensors, web platforms, and specialized repositories. The preprocessing stage is critical, involving:
- Removing duplicate entries
- Handling missing data points
- Normalizing numerical features
- Encoding categorical variables
Model Training and Optimization
AI technology function reaches its peak during model training. Data scientists select appropriate algorithms, feed preprocessed data, and allow machine learning models to adjust internal parameters. Optimization techniques help refine the model's performance, ensuring accurate predictions and robust problem-solving capabilities.

How do large language models like ChatGPT work?
Large Language Models (LLMs) are trained on massive text datasets, learning statistical patterns of language. Using transformer architectures with attention mechanisms, they can understand context, generate human-like text, answer questions, and perform various language-related tasks by predicting likely word sequences based on their extensive training.
